Statues of the Old South: Charles Lincoln speaks during a candleligh­t vigil at the statue of Jefferson Davis in New Orleans on Monday. New Orleans will begin taking down Confederat­e statutes, becoming the latest Southern body to divorce itself from what some say are symbols of racism and intoleranc­e. See report at right.
